source("../../shared/qtcreator.py")
SpeedCrunchPath = ""
BuildPath = tempDir()
def cmakeSupportsServerMode():
versionLines = filter(lambda line: "cmake version " in line,
getOutputFromCmdline(["cmake", "--version"]).splitlines())
try:
test.log("Using " + versionLines[0])
matcher = re.match("cmake version (\d+)\.(\d+)\.\d+", versionLines[0])
major = __builtin__.int(matcher.group(1))
minor = __builtin__.int(matcher.group(2))
except:
return False
if major < 3:
return False
elif major > 3:
return True
else:
return minor >= 7
def main():
if (which("cmake") == None):
test.fatal("cmake not found in PATH - needed to run this test")
return
if not neededFilePresent(SpeedCrunchPath):
return
startApplication("qtcreator" + SettingsPath)
if not startedWithoutPluginError():
return
result = openCmakeProject(SpeedCrunchPath, BuildPath)
if not result:
test.fatal("Could not open/create cmake project - leaving test")
invokeMenuItem("File", "Exit")
return
progressBarWait(30000)
naviTreeView = "{column='0' container=':Qt Creator_Utils::NavigationTreeView' text~='%s' type='QModelIndex'}"
if cmakeSupportsServerMode():
treeFile = "projecttree_speedcrunch_server.tsv"
else:
treeFile = "projecttree_speedcrunch.tsv"
compareProjectTree(naviTreeView % "speedcrunch( \[\S+\])?", treeFile)
if not cmakeSupportsServerMode() and JIRA.isBugStillOpen(18290):
test.xfail("Building with cmake in Tealeafreader mode may fail", "QTCREATORBUG-18290")
else:
# Invoke a rebuild of the application
invokeMenuItem("Build", "Rebuild All")
# Wait for, and test if the build succeeded
waitForCompile(300000)
checkCompile()
checkLastBuild()
invokeMenuItem("File", "Exit")
def init():
global SpeedCrunchPath
SpeedCrunchPath = srcPath + "/creator-test-data/speedcrunch/src/CMakeLists.txt"
cleanup()
def cleanup():
global BuildPath
# Make sure the .user files are gone
cleanUpUserFiles(SpeedCrunchPath)
deleteDirIfExists(BuildPath)
